At the core of reputation management is consistent and high-quality content. Live music blogs thrive on timely updates, honest reviews, and exclusive coverage of events. By delivering accurate and engaging reporting, blogs build credibility with both readers and performers. Transparency in coverage, including acknowledging both strengths and weaknesses of performances, helps establish a blog as a reliable source rather than a promotional outlet.
Another critical aspect is active audience engagement. Comments, social media interactions, and community forums are essential platforms where readers express opinions. Successful blogs monitor these channels carefully, responding to questions, clarifying misunderstandings, and addressing complaints promptly. This level of attentiveness signals to audiences that the blog values feedback, fostering loyalty and positive perception.
Monitoring online presence is equally important. Live music blogs utilize tools to track mentions across social media, review sites, and search engines. Early detection of negative posts or misinformation allows blog managers to respond quickly and professionally. By addressing potential issues before they escalate, blogs can maintain a constructive narrative and protect their reputation.
Furthermore, collaboration with artists and industry professionals can enhance credibility. Exclusive interviews, backstage insights, and partnerships with event organizers demonstrate authority and deepen the blog’s connection with the music scene. However, maintaining journalistic integrity while collaborating is key to avoid perceptions of bias, which could harm reputation.
Finally, live music blogs often implement proactive content strategies to highlight positive achievements. Featuring rising talent, promoting community events, and celebrating industry milestones not only enriches content but also reinforces a positive brand image.
In a crowded digital space, live music blogs must balance honesty, engagement, and strategic visibility to sustain a strong online reputation. Through consistent quality, attentive interaction, vigilant monitoring, and meaningful collaborations, these blogs ensure their voices remain trusted and influential in the live music community.
